A safety data sheet has a fixed shape, and this checks it against that shape
Every Canadian safety data sheet is built to the same sixteen headings in the same order, under the Hazardous Products Regulations: pick up a sheet for any hazardous product and section 4 is always first-aid measures. The nuance almost every checklist gets wrong
Sections 1 to 11 and 16 have to carry real content. Where something genuinely does not apply, the sheet says so in words, "not applicable" or "not available", rather than sitting blank.
Sections 12 to 15, ecological information, disposal considerations, transport information and regulatory information, are different, and CCOHS is direct about it: the heading has to appear on every sheet, but the supplier has the option not to provide the content underneath it. A checklist that treats all sixteen the same way reports a document as incomplete for something Canadian regulation explicitly allows. This tool scores only the twelve sections that must carry content, and says plainly when 12 to 15 are blank that the gap is permitted rather than a fault.

The 90 day rule, and what it is not
A supplier has to update a sheet within 90 days of becoming aware of significant new hazard information: data that shifts the product's classification, moves it into another hazard class, or changes how to protect against the hazard. Buy the product inside that window and the supplier owes both the current sheet and a separate document stating what is changing.
What the rule is not is a fixed shelf life. Nothing ties an update duty to a calendar interval on its own, so an old sheet for an unchanged product is not automatically stale. The clock runs only from a specific piece of new information becoming known, which is why this tool asks for a date rather than printing an expiry: with none given, there is genuinely nothing to calculate.
A name that is missing on purpose
Section 3 sometimes shows a code name or number instead of an ingredient. That can be proper: a supplier may withhold an exact identity as confidential business information, but only after filing a claim under the Hazardous Materials Information Review Act, and the sheet still has to reference the resulting registry number rather than stay silent. An identity simply absent, with no registry number cited anywhere, has not cleared that bar, and this tool treats the two differently.
No exposure limit number, on the same basis as the UK tool
This tool does not carry an occupational exposure limit figure, and it never will. Section 8 requires the source of any exposure guideline to be named alongside the figure itself, which is the regulation signalling that WHMIS does not fix one national number. The figure and its source belong on the sheet in front of you, not on a free tool to guess. It is the same decision the COSHH assessment tool makes about workplace exposure limits: a stale figure gets trusted, and a missing one at least prompts somebody to look. The two tools are counterparts rather than translations of each other: COSHH carries its own British control hierarchy, and WHMIS 2015 is Canada's own hazard communication system, built round this sixteen section sheet and a supplier label.

Common questions
Is a safety data sheet legally required for every hazardous product in Canada?
Yes, from the supplier. The Hazardous Products Act and the Hazardous Products Regulations require a supplier to provide a safety data sheet with a hazardous product sold or imported for use in a Canadian workplace. Health Canada is the federal regulator behind that duty. What an employer then has to do with the sheet on their own site, training, storage, making it available, is enforced provincially or federally depending on whose workplace it is.

Does an old safety data sheet automatically count as out of date?
No. There is no fixed shelf life written into the rule. The 90 day clock only starts once the supplier has become aware of significant new hazard information, so a five-year-old sheet for an unchanged product is not out of date on age alone. This tool will not invent an expiry date it has no source for: without a specific date of awareness, there is nothing to calculate.

Is this the same as a COSHH assessment?
No. COSHH is a UK regulation built around its own control hierarchy and its own workplace exposure limit list, EH40, which that tool deliberately does not carry either. WHMIS 2015 is a different instrument entirely: Canada's own hazard communication system, built on the sixteen section format and a supplier label rather than an employer-written control hierarchy. This tool is the Canadian counterpart in subject, not a translation of the British one.
